Durham University Graduates formally received their degrees in absentia this week, after formal ceremonies were postponed until the summer of 2022. The university recorded a video to mark the occasion which can be found here. In an email, Vice-Chancellor and Warden Stuart Corbridge told graduating students: “During a year as unprecedented as this one, your achievements are a testament to your hard work and dedication”. The Vice-Chancellor emphasised that the online ceremony “is not replacing the summer ceremonies. All graduates who indicated a wish to be invited to a rescheduled ceremony during the Congregation & Parchment registration process will receive further information via email in due course.”
